The year’s accomplishments

Over the last year, McCann Health achieved significant growth of 6.5 percent globally. The agency also gained recognition as global thought leaders/ navigators to Pharma 3.0 through its unique proprietary platform, global health experts in the developed and developing world, and as a global powerhouse in medical marketing and consultancy, executives say.

At the beginning of 2014, McCann Americas welcomed Amar Urhekar as the new president of the Americas. A McCann Health veteran with proven leadership and experience in managing and leading individual markets and regions, he has spent the past year expanding the culture of growth and integration, bringing all the agencies together, and taking the network’s relationships with clients to the next level. Under Amar’s direction, McCann Health North America continues to grow steadily, with more than 130 new employees and more than 45 new assignments across all McCann Health agencies in 2014.

In Asia Pacific, Graeme Read was elevated to president and Mark Worman took on the new role of head of global marketing. Over the last five years, APAC has supported the success of McCann Health by being the single most awarded region, most notably earning the Campaign Asia’s Specialist Agency Network of the Year for Asia Pacific, four times in five years. China has won the Agency of the Year accolade for four years, between 2010 and 2013, and Japan an unprecedented five straight years, between 2010 and 2014.

In Europe, with Michel Nakache at the helm, McCann Health’s influence is unsurpassed with a stronghold of healthcare dedicated agencies in the main markets across the region, executives say. Clients such as Novartis and AstraZeneca with global and regional headquarters in Europe are extending their relationships and discussions with McCann Health. This has spurred double-digit growth in the past year, an achievement in itself but exceptional given the economic challenge within the region, executives say.

McCann Global Health, led by Andrew Schirmer, continued its upward momentum, with an important new global assignment from Johnson & Johnson, continued work with UNICEF, and greater overall access and revenue from its current campaigns. “As one of the few healthcare agencies with a global and public focus, McCann Global Health has a unique and distinctive offering, providing advertising and marketing that reaches isolated audiences and can truly resonate with them, making them an unmatched creative and strategic agency, and a much needed and appreciated resource for the global health community,” executives say.

Structure and services

According to network leaders, McCann Health saw a spectacular year end finish, with every agency in the network gaining significant wins and showing solid growth, positioning the network for a successful 2015. 

In North America, McCann HumanCare had a year of explosive double-digit growth under the leadership of newly appointed President Leo Tarkovsky, with even better expected in 2015. McCann Humancare added 12 new assignments from a wide range of clients including USPS and Reckitt Benckiser and diversified its offering from almost entirely pharma to more than 40 percent OTC.

McCann Torre Lazur (MTL), with Bill McEllen as president, won 2014 Med Ad News Agency of the Year and saw a 20 percent success rate of all U.S. launches in 2013 (see profile on page 80). Having won the Agency of the Year for the seventh time in 2014, MTL has further built on its growth and awards equity with nominations in three prestigious categories in 2015. In addition, MTL was single handedly responsible for launching 20 percent of new molecules approved by the FDA in 2013.

McCann Echo TL rechristened itself to become McCann Echo, and with Sonja Foster-Storch as president, achieved spectacular overall growth and creative performance (see profile on page 76). As a result, it was nominated for Agency of the Year in Category II. In 2013, McCann Echo was a Med Ad News finalist and won the Most Admired Agency of the Year.

McCann RCW, under the leadership of President Susan Duffy, integrated more fully into the McCann Health global network, added several new accounts including AZ Diabetes, AZ Immuno Oncology, Seattle Genetics, and Eisai and expanded its offer, boosting digital, planning and creative capabilities.

McCann Managed Markets, led by Kim Wishnow-Per, is now a 50-staff agency working with a variety of clients across the United States. It is one of the few managed markets agencies to win a creative award, for its work on the Bob Woodruff Foundation.

According to network leaders, McCann Pharmacy Initiative is building upon the expertise of McCann Health in the ever-changing pharmacy landscape and the role of pharmacists in the new world of the Affordable Care Act. Sandra Carey, an experienced and qualified pharmacist and regulator herself, is leading this exciting initiative.

McCann Complete Medical and Double Helix have become increasingly integrated under the leadership of Charlie Buckwell, CEO. His role in further globalizing the two agencies and strengthening their primary branches of insightful discoveries and strategic consulting has led to great success from both agencies. This group experienced record growth in 2014 and given the market environment and the industry’s need for compliant, innovative communication programs is set for a spectacular 2015, executives say.
